Chinese Seniors Drum Up Joy and Wellbeing
Quick Smiles:
- China’s growing senior population embraces energetic drumming classes.
- Programs boost physical, mental, and social wellness for retirees.
- Enrichment activities help seniors rediscover joy and purpose.
Across China, retirees are joining vibrant drumming classes, showing there’s no age limit to having fun and learning new skills.
These classes not only invite women to express themselves musically, but also strengthen their physical and cognitive wellbeing as part of the country’s focus on active aging.
“They are recording improvements in physical, mental, and cognitive well-being that increase economic well-being,” said Merril Silverstein, a sociologist at Syracuse University.
The weekly drum sessions also keep costs low while offering a sense of camaraderie and youthfulness that goes beyond traditional enrichment courses.
From dance and vocals to flower arranging, Hunan Province’s programs invite older adults to discover fresh activities and make the most of retirement.
